>much more content
>combat structured better
>different ways to approach enemies because of all of the weapon types
>building things is actually important
>better lighting system
>bosses
>actually valid incentive to dig underground other than ore, as in, legendary equipment
>enemies that force players to change their strategy mid-fight
>progression is as linear as starbound while still managing to be a more exciting experience
>RNG system that adds additional buffs/debuffs to weapons upon crafting
>armor set bonuses
>less atrocious UI

and the list goes on and on. how can starboundfags even compete?

and don't tell me that it'll get better with development. starbound has been in development for at least five years and only began 'releasing' a bit ago.

>>385850727
None that I've encountered after a ton of hours. Prefixes will fuck you up sometimes though during bosses due to the way it works.
As it stands Calamity and Thorium will kick in right towards the start, and Spirit is mostly Hardmode stuff. Calamity will easily last the longest though, with 8 Post-Moon Lord bosses (4 are kinda mini-bosses, another is a Super boss).
>>385850893
Very rarely. I think Tremors is the only one that gets issues.

>>385851307
Depends on where you're at. Up until Moon Lord Thorium stays pretty in pace, with the namesake Ore being only slightly better than Gold initially. The Pre-Mechanical phase does have a particular armor set that makes them piss easy, if only for allowing constant Gravity Potion effect.
Calamity is crazy though, with pre-ML bosses that are even harder than him solo (Leviathan comes to mind). Nothing Pre-Hardmode is too powerful, but when you get towards ML you start getting some stuff that's much stronger than vanilla (Albeit with harder bosses added in to gate it). Killing ML once is enough to get gear that puts him on farm though, with the bosses after him being ludicrous. IIRC, the max life without armor/accessory bonuses is 700. And melee gets good stuff for boosting max HP.

>>385846056

>much more content
That's true, but Terraria has many years on Starbound. Regardless, redigit is a beast with how much content he's pumped out.
>combat structured better
They are both pretty similar.
>different ways to approach enemies because of all of the weapon types
They are both pretty similar, but Starbound also introduces monster elemental affinities
>building things is actually important
That can be a positive or a negative. If you're playing Terraria for the gameplay, then you're forced into building a bunch of small corridors just so you can progress efficiently.
>better lighting system
I disagree. Starbound has a much smoother dynamic lighting system.
>bosses
Oh, yeah. Totally. Starbound doesn't even come close.
>actually valid incentive to dig underground other than ore, as in, legendary equipment
Starbound has much more vault-like content than Terraria. Though, it's usually underwhelming since after many updates the best stuff can be crafted or found through quests.
>enemies that force players to change their strategy mid-fight
If you mean by running away to reset potion timers, sure. Otherwise no reason to switch off your best weapon.
>progression is as linear as starbound while still managing to be a more exciting experience
That's true, but mostly do to the feel good moment of defeating a boss for the first time.
>RNG system that adds additional buffs/debuffs to weapons upon crafting
Yeah, Starbound could use a moneysink like one of those.
>armor set bonuses
Frackin' Universe mod, which everyone should have installed, supplies about thirty sets of gear with set bonuses.
>less atrocious UI
Nawww. Starbound actually has separate tabs for blocks, ores, and weapons.
